That'll be a 13 pin euro (oh no not them again!) plug.

You can buy a convertor. expect to pay around 25 quid

If it is a 13 pin plug, best idea is to convert the caravan to 13 pin. Much superior.

All the new vans are 13 pin.

If you have a swan neck towbar you will not be able to fit a backplate on. They are for twin bolt bars only. My swan neck bar has a spare connector for the breakaway cable below the rear bumper, if there is not one there, you will have to loop the breakaway round the bar and clip it back onto itself.
